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Power output and outlets: Match continuous wattage (and peak if needed) to devices you plan to power. Dual AC outlets are helpful for laptops, CPAP machines, and small appliances, while USB-C PD ports speed up charging for modern devices.
- Port selection: USB-C PD, USB-A QC, and multiple USB ports enable charging different devices simultaneously. Consider devices that support USB-C Power Delivery for faster charging.
- Portability and size: If you travel light, a compact unit is easier to store. For family trips with multiple devices, a larger inverter with more outlets may be preferable.
- Cooling and safety: Look for smart cooling fans and protections for over-voltage, over-current, overload, short-circuit, and high temperature. These features extend inverter life and protect devices.
- Vehicle compatibility: Most inverters fit standard 12V cigarette lighter sockets, but check cord length (often around 30 inches or more) to ensure flexible placement inside your vehicle.
- Durability and build: Aluminum housings and robust materials improve heat dissipation and longevity during frequent travel or heavy use.
- Use-case alignment: Road trips, camping, work-from-road scenarios, and powering medical devices require different power profiles. Prioritize models that align with your most frequent needs.
- Maintenance and heat management: Inverters generate heat; ensure adequate ventilation and avoid running high-wattage loads for extended periods without breaks to prevent overheating.
Compared perspectives: For high-demand devices like laptops and CPAP machines, models with 300W–400W continuous power, dual AC outlets, and USB-C PD ports are advantageous. For lighter use, 150W–200W units with multiple USB ports may suffice and offer greater portability. Consider whether you need a long cord, a compact form factor, or a unit that supports fast charging across several devices at once.
